During biotherapeutic production, a range of impurities and variants can be generated, including host cell proteins (HCPs). HCPs present a safety risk as they can produce immunogenic responses and may reduce drug efficacy. To meet regulatory criteria, developers must verify that HCPs have been reduced to an acceptable level.

To keep up with the rapidly growing biotherapeutic industry, the large analytical toolkit of techniques for HCP analysis has continued to evolve.
